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Lake Elmo's abundance of open space and natural areas creates a real opportunity to use Minnesota native plants in residential landscaping. Incorporating species like prairie smoke, blue wild indigo, and native sedges along property borders connects home landscapes to the surrounding rural character Lake Elmo is known for. Native plantings require no supplemental irrigation once established in Zone 4b and thrive in the sandy loam soils common throughout Lake Elmo without annual soil amendment.

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Apply bulk shredded hardwood mulch in Lake Elmo beds at 3 inches each spring after the May 5 last frost. This timing allows soil to warm naturally before the mulch layer insulates it, speeding perennial emergence and supporting root development through June. For fall, add 1 to 2 extra inches before October 5 to give Zone 4b perennials the root-zone protection they need through Lake Elmo's cold, sometimes snowless winters.

How do I prevent my Lake Elmo mulched beds from washing away during heavy spring rains?

Use shredded hardwood mulch rather than bark nuggets or wood chips on sloped Lake Elmo beds. Shredded material knits together and resists movement far better during heavy spring rainfall events. On slopes steeper than 15 degrees, install edging at the downhill bed border as a physical barrier. A 3 to 4 inch depth gives you a buffer even if the top inch displaces during an intense storm.

Is bulk topsoil or compost better for filling new garden beds in Lake Elmo?

For new beds in Lake Elmo, a blend of both delivers the best results. Pure compost alone is too light and can become hydrophobic when it dries,a concern in Lake Elmo's sandy loam environment during dry summer stretches. A 60/40 topsoil-to-compost ratio creates a well-draining, nutrient-rich base that holds moisture better than native soil alone and supports strong plant establishment through the full growing season.

What bulk stone options work best for Lake Elmo's rural-character landscaping aesthetic?

Natural fieldstone, granite boulders, and tumbled river rock are all popular in Lake Elmo, where homeowners favor naturalistic landscapes that complement the open rural surroundings. Fieldstone dry-stacked into low retaining walls or border accents fits the local character particularly well. Crushed limestone works for functional paths and driveways. Avoid overly polished or brightly colored stone, which can look out of place in Lake Elmo's more natural setting.
